The Most In-Demand Tech Skills To Learn For 2021

Date Jan 26, 2021
Blog category Broadband
By Staff Writer

As the world of technology continues its rapid growth, more and more companies are looking for professionals with advanced tech skills to help them grow and stay ahead of their competitors. 

Whether you're running a business, a job seeker, or an employee who wants to step up your game and increase your demand, it's essential to keep up with these trends and add a new skill to your resume. With hundreds of tech skills to choose from, it can be challenging to know where to start, what skills to learn, and which one will benefit you or your business the most.

With the help of Skillsoft Tech Signals, "Lean Into Tech: 2020 Tech Skills Trends and 2021 Predictions", we've rounded up some of the most in-demand tech skills this year across five critical areas: software craft, data, programming, cloud, and security. These areas, when applied and learned well, can definitely help businesses grow. Employees on the other hand can take more of these courses to further increase their value.

Data analytics

Data analysis is one — if not the main — driver of businesses' growth these days! Without all these easy-to-extract data, how are you supposed to understand the market? Data analytics is one very important process to learn and discover useful information about products and consumers among other thingsgs, and develop conclusions for decision-making and the next course of action. Today, most companies have access to a great deal of information on customers, such as their interests, spending habits, behaviors, and more.

It is predicted that more organizations and businesses will prioritize securing data storage and remote access this year, which means learning fundamental data analysis can give you an opportunity to help in decision-making roles — an essential life-skill in today's data-driven environment. More importantly, the benefits of data analysis can be used for critical business insights, identify market trends before competitors, and gain advantages for your business.

Top Courses to Take:

  • Data Gathering
  • Power Bi: Getting Started With Data Analytics
  • the Big Data Technology Wave

Internet too slow for work? It's time to switch! Use CompareBear's FREE Broadband comparison tool to find the best deals in your area.


Agile can be daunting, especially if you're not familiar with the term and are new to project management. No worries though, because it's not as complicated as you think! Agile is simply one of the most common guides used in project management to choose methods and procedures that will work best for your team.

Its values and principles don't try to prescribe the way your team should work; instead, it focuses on helping you and your team think and interact in ways that achieve agility or the ability to continually adapt and continuously make improvements to the way you work. Now that we're experiencing so many changes worldwide, learning this skill can be of great help for you and your team to adjust and stay on top of your game.

Top Courses to Take:

  • Agile Software Testing: Methodologies and Testing Approaches
  • Agile Software Development: Agile Development Life Cycle

Cloud fundamentals

Many companies are shying away from traditional server infrastructure to rely on cloud solutions, and demand for skilled workers in these areas has increased. With cloud technology opening up new revenue channels, it's the perfect time to start learning the fundamentals of cloud and be amazed at how it can benefit you and your business. Whether you're considering a career in cloud computing, or want to incorporate cloud technologies into your organization's infrastructure, understanding cloud fundamentals is a skill worth learning.

Top Courses to Take:

  • Cloud Computing Fundamentals: Introduction
  • Azure Fundamentals: Cloud Computing


DevOps or Development and Operations is becoming more popular in the tech industry and will continue to do so this year. If you're not familiar with it, you might think it's a programming language or tool that you can learn, but DevOps is the combination of cultural philosophies, practices, and tools used by businesses to meet the growing demands of customers. With this tool, you can speed up processes and development cycles, all while maintaining a high degree of accuracy and not compromising security. This is to make sure that new features reach the users as quickly and as smoothly as possible.

Top Courses to Take:

  • DevOps Testing and Delivery
  • DevOps Management and Capabilities
  • DevOps Methodologies and Development

Now that you know some of the best tech skills to learn, it's time to do some e-learning!

Entering the world of tech can be intimidating if you’re just starting, but the internet is full of excellent resources and online courses for beginners! And yes, even some of the most relevant content are given for free!

Ready to take online courses?

Make sure you get a reliable broadband plan from a local provider in New Zealand, for uninterrupted classes!

Get the best broadband plan for your smart and IoT devices using our comparison tool, right here at CompareBear.